### What changes were proposed in this pull request?
This PR updates the `ParseType` class to support parsing of nested complex
types (e.g. `list(list(integer))`, `map(string,list(integer))`).
### Why are the changes needed?
Currently, the CLI only supports simple types or single-level lists/maps.
It fails for more complex definitions like `list(list(integer))` or
`map(string,list(integer))`.
Fix: #8159
### Does this PR introduce _any_ user-facing change?
Users can now define more complex schemas in the CLI, such as:
- `list(list(integer))`
- `map(string,list(integer))`
### How was this patch tested?
- Added new unit tests:
- `testParseTypeNestedList`
- `testParseTypeMapWithNestedValue`
- Executed existing unit tests
